Description
This edition provides an in-depth look at the TCP/IP Internet protocols. It presents a complete implementation, showing the internals of the TCP/IP protocol software, with actual code.

Content
Introduction and overview; the structure of TCP/IP software in an operating system; network interface layer; address discovery and binding (ARP); IP - global software organization; IP - routing table and routing algorithm; IP - fragmentation and reassembly; IP - error processing (ICMP); IP - multicast processing (IGMP); UDP - user datagrams; TCP - data structures and input processing; TCP - finite state machine implementation; TCP - output processing; TCP - timer management; TCP - flow control and adaptive retransmission; TCP - urgent data processing and the push function; socket-level interface; RIP - active route propagation and passive acquisition; OSPF - route propagation with an SPF algorithm; SNMP - MIB variables, representations and bindings; SNMP - client and server; SNMP table access functions; implementation in retrospect; appendices.
